#67c6ac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#67c6ac is composed of 40.4% red, 77.6%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.1%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 163.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 59%. #67c6ac color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ffff with #008d59.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#67c6ac

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020504 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#67c6ac

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9e9a is the less saturated color, while #2ffec5 is the most saturated one.
